WebWhy is graphite slippery to touch? The various layers of carbon atoms in graphite are held together by weak van der waal's forces so these can slide over one another and therefore, graphite is slippery to touch. WebGraphite possesses a layer structure with two successive layers held by weak force and able to slide over one another. So, graphite is slippery and this property finds its use as a lubricant. In graphite, each carbon atom is linked to three other carbon atoms while one electron in the carbon atom is delocalised. So, graphite has free electrons.
